The Asahi Shimbun is a Japanese leading newspaper and the company additionally offers a substantial data service through the internet. The firm has a century-long custom of philanthropic support, notably staging key exhibitions in Japan on art, tradition and history from all over the world. In addition to the Asahi Shimbun Displays, The Asahi Shimbun Company is a dedicated supporter of the British Museum touring exhibition programme in Japan, and funder of The Asahi Shimbun Gallery of Amaravati sculpture in Room 33a.

Born in the United States to Japanese immigrants from Nara, Kathy Matsui moved to Japan at the age of 25 for a career as a monetary strategist. She is credited with coining the term “womenomics” in a report she penned in 1999 and is thought for her function in selling Japanese women’s participation in the workforce. Matsui argued that Japanese girls need extra assist in order to have the ability to return to work after having kids, and that this may shut the gender work gap whereas promoting financial development and serving to Japan’s falling birthrate. Her proposal has been embraced and promoted by Prime Minister Shinzo Abe.

A comparable distinction—that of regular and non-regular staff (part-time, short-term, and different indirect workers)—is especially salient in Japan. Using this categorization, it’s obvious that a substantially bigger portion of prime-age women are engaged in non-traditional (and often lower-quality) jobs, with the share growing from 44.2 percent in 2000 to 51.0 p.c in 2016. Non-regular employees aremore prone to have interaction in routine tasks,much less more probably to qualify for public pension insurance coverage, andless likely to see wage will increase all through their careers.

Historical sources offer few accounts of the onna-bugeisha, as the traditional role of a Japanese noblewoman was restricted to homemaker and wife. Between the twelfth and 19th centuries, these upper-class girls have been educated within the art of warfare and using the naginata, primarily to defend themselves and their properties. The onna-bugeisha belonged to the bushi, a noble class of feudal Japanese warriors who existed lengthy before the term “samurai” came into utilization. I additionally visited the workplace of POSSE, a gaggle formed by college graduates who needed to create a labor union for young people. Haruki Konno, the group’s president, told me that a number of the younger males in irregular jobs turn out to be what are called “net-café refugees”—people who reside within the tiny cubicles out there for rent overnight at Japanese internet cafés.
